The working principle of the invention is:
Rotate one 1-2 of control-rod fixed plate by shaking one 1-1 of control-rod, to drive connection one 1-3 rotation, connection
Rotation is passed to one 1-4 of helical gear by one 1-3, and one 1-4 of helical gear is engaged with two 1-5 of helical gear, and two 1-5 of helical gear rotation passes through
One 1-6 of connecting rod passes to three 1-7 of helical gear, and three 1-7 of helical gear is engaged with four 1-8 of helical gear, rotates four 1-8 of helical gear,
Four 1-8 of helical gear moves up and down one 1-11 of screw rod, to realize elevating function by screw thread;
Rotate two 4-2 of control-rod fixed plate by shaking two 4-1 of control-rod, two 4-2 of control-rod fixed plate rotation passes through
One 4-3 of belt passes to one 4-4 of belt wheel, and rotation is passed to wheel 4-5 by one 4-4 of belt wheel, to realize locomotive function;
Rotate three 5-2 of control-rod fixed plate by shaking three 5-1 of control-rod, three 5-2 of control-rod fixed plate rotation drives
One 5-3 of bidirectional helical screw rod rotation, one 5-3 of bidirectional helical screw rod rotation are contacted by screw thread with one 5-4 of push plate, realize push plate one
5-4 is moved left and right, and one 5-3 of bidirectional helical screw rod rotation is contacted by screw thread with two 5-6 of push plate, realizes that two 5-6 of push plate or so is moved
It is dynamic, link mechanism 5-8 is pushed when one 5-4 of push plate and two 5-6 of push plate are moved left and right, link mechanism 5-8 is unstable using quadrangle
Property, drive seat 2 to move up and down, to realize seat elevating function;
Rotate four 6-2 of control-rod fixed plate by shaking four 6-1 of control-rod, four 6-2 of control-rod fixed plate rotation drives
Two 6-3 of bidirectional helical screw rod rotation, to rotate with two 6-4 of movable belt pulley, two 6-4 of belt wheel rotation is passed to by two 6-5 of belt
Three 6-6 of belt wheel, so that three 6-7 of bidirectional helical screw rod is driven to rotate, two 6-3 of bidirectional helical screw rod and three 6-7 of bidirectional helical screw rod
Right fixture block 6-8 is driven to move left and right with left fixture block 6-9 by screw thread when rotation, to be inserted on thick bar 6-10 and thin bar 6-11
Aperture realizes fixed function;
Operating stick connecting rod 7-2 movement, operating stick connecting rod 7-2 fortune are driven by shake operation bar 7-1, operating stick 7-1
Dynamic that clock 7-3 is driven to swing, clock 7-3 can collide hammer 7-4 when swinging, to realize call function.
